How Was Liverpool Affected By The Industrial Revolution?

Throughout the industrial revolution, Liverpool became the world’s leading city for cotton production, as well as continuing to experience a boom in its other industries – including slavery. Is Liverpool Making A Profit?

Liverpool have announced their financial results for the financial year ending in May 2021, with the Merseyside club posting a pre-tax loss of £4.8 million. Their pre-tax loss fell by £41.5 million from the previous financial year. Is Liverpool profitable? How Long Did Liverpool Get Banned From Europe?

six years. Thirty-nine people—mostly Italians and Juventus fans—were killed and 600 were injured in the confrontation. Heysel Stadium disaster. Date 29 May 1985 Outcome English clubs banned from European competition for five years; Liverpool for six years Deaths 39 Non-fatal injuries 600 Arrests 34 When did Liverpool ban English clubs from Europe?
